Benji’s career at Easter road appears to be over after Egyptian champions Al-Ahly claimed they had signed the Moroccan international striker on a 3 year deal worth around £500,000.
Pictures have appeared on the Egyptian club’s website of Benjelloun shaking hands with officials, but a spokesman for the Easter Road side said permission had given to the player to secure a new club, on the condition that the agreement suited all parties according to The Scotsman website…

Rob Jones completed a move from Easter Road to Championship side Scunthorpe United.
The 29-year-old defender signed a three-year deal with the newly promoted side for an undisclosed fee on Wednesday night.
Jones met with Scunthorpe manager Nigel Adkins yesterday and agreed terms for his spell at Glanford Park.
Jones told the Scunthorpe official website, “It feels great to sign for Scunthorpe United”, “It’s nice to be back in England and in an area which I’m familiar with after my time at Grimsby.

Hibernian have confirmed the signing of midfielder Kevin McBride on a free transfer from Falkirk.
Skysports.com revealed that McBride had agreed to follow former Falkirk boss John Hughes to Hibs following the end of his Bairns contract.
McBride is understood to have secured a two-year deal at Easter Road and is relishing the chance to play for Hibs.
“I have always been a great admirer of the way that Hibernian aim to play the game, and I can’t wait now to get started as a Hibernian player,” McBride told the club’s official website.

Hibs have made a surprise announcement by revealing that left winger Alan O’Brien’s contract has been terminated to let him explore other career opportunities.
The Republic of Ireland international has never managed to win over the fans at Easter Road but his release has still come as something of a shock as his contract still had 2 years to run.
O’Brien was signed by John Collins who saw him as a direct replacement for the departed Ivan Sproule and was quoted as saying “Alan’s like Ivan Sproule on a motorbike”.

Burnley boss Owen Coyle has strengthened his strikeforce by snapping up Hibernian’s Steven Fletcher for a club record £3million transfer fee.
The 22-year-old Scotland international has agreed a four-year deal at Turf Moor after scoring 51 goals in 189 appearances for the SPL side.
Fletcher has represented his country on four occasions, the last being the Euro 2008 qualifying victory against Iceland in April.
He came through the youth team ranks at Easter Road before making his first-team debut as a substitute in the 3-0 victory against Kilmarnock in April 2004.

Falkirk keeper Dani Mallo has confirmed he knows where his footballing future lies but refused to name his new club until Wednesday.
The 30 year old stopper has been strongly linked with a move to Easter Road and new gaffer John Hughes has refused to rule out the possibility of re-acquainting himself with the Spaniard at his new home.
